loopinnova 发表于 2015-4-1 12:02:25

关于FPGA+OV7670视频采集传输

小弟现在的项目是FPGA采集OV7670的图像通过串口传输到上位机,刚学习FPGA,请各位大大指点下如何入手。

蓝色风暴@FPGA 发表于 2015-4-1 12:06:36

通过串口,你是采集图片还是采集视频??

yuxiang2 发表于 2015-4-1 12:13:14

都上FPGA了,采集的图像还通过串口送到上位机

lulinchen 发表于 2015-4-1 13:28:45

学生吧,

loopinnova 发表于 2015-4-1 13:41:54

蓝色风暴@FPGA 发表于 2015-4-1 12:06
通过串口,你是采集图片还是采集视频??

采集的是视频

loopinnova 发表于 2015-4-1 13:42:40

yuxiang2 发表于 2015-4-1 12:13
都上FPGA了,采集的图像还通过串口送到上位机

没办法 学渣一枚 老师让学FPGA

loopinnova 发表于 2015-4-1 13:43:03

lulinchen 发表于 2015-4-1 13:28
学生吧,

是啊。。

cxhy 发表于 2015-4-1 15:07:11

传视频的话至少来个网口吧。串口的速度恐怕有点问题啊

loopinnova 发表于 2015-4-1 16:32:13

cxhy 发表于 2015-4-1 15:07
传视频的话至少来个网口吧。串口的速度恐怕有点问题啊

OV7670的数据量应该算小的吧

jssd 发表于 2015-4-1 16:47:34

再小串口也传不了。FPGA直接驱动VGA显示更好

pengchhui 发表于 2015-4-1 17:20:33

好歹也USB吧,串口能传几帧呀

huchl 发表于 2015-4-1 18:02:26

不知道你用啥FPGA做的,我们使用ZYNQ 采集800W的摄像头一点压力都没有{:smile:}

cxhy 发表于 2015-4-2 09:33:07

要不然直接走DMA也是一个办法

loopinnova 发表于 2015-4-2 10:10:52

jssd 发表于 2015-4-1 16:47
再小串口也传不了。FPGA直接驱动VGA显示更好

现在是想实现无线 有现成的串口转WIFI 所以这样想的。。

loopinnova 发表于 2015-4-2 10:11:09

pengchhui 发表于 2015-4-1 17:20
好歹也USB吧,串口能传几帧呀

USB没弄过听说比串口难很多。。

loopinnova 发表于 2015-4-2 10:11:30

huchl 发表于 2015-4-1 18:02
不知道你用啥FPGA做的,我们使用ZYNQ 采集800W的摄像头一点压力都没有...

可以用串口传输么?

loopinnova 发表于 2015-4-2 10:12:37

cxhy 发表于 2015-4-2 09:33
要不然直接走DMA也是一个办法

FPGA也有DMA?

gnocy 发表于 2015-4-2 10:30:05

直接告诉你,你这个方案就不行,采集可以,串口就不要想了。直接接个屏不就可以了

huchl 发表于 2015-4-2 10:37:03

loopinnova 发表于 2015-4-2 10:11
可以用串口传输么?

当然可以啊,只是这个桢率,就..........





















http://item.taobao.com/item.htm?id=43264239149

loopinnova 发表于 2015-4-2 10:43:04

gnocy 发表于 2015-4-2 10:30
直接告诉你,你这个方案就不行,采集可以,串口就不要想了。直接接个屏不就可以了 ...

喔= =// 有人做VGA的 关于无线传输采集的视频有什么方法呢

MetalSeed 发表于 2015-4-2 10:46:12

串口压力太大

gnocy 发表于 2015-4-2 10:47:28

loopinnova 发表于 2015-4-2 10:43
喔= =// 有人做VGA的 关于无线传输采集的视频有什么方法呢

你还想做VGA无线传输啊,这个不是一般的难,是很难非常的难

loopinnova 发表于 2015-4-2 12:17:53

gnocy 发表于 2015-4-2 10:47
你还想做VGA无线传输啊,这个不是一般的难,是很难非常的难

嗯?就是把FPGA采集的视频通过无线传输到PC 有什么方法

loopinnova 发表于 2015-4-2 12:18:37

MetalSeed 发表于 2015-4-2 10:46
串口压力太大

嗯 那有什么无线方式可以传输的

蓝色风暴@FPGA 发表于 2015-4-2 12:28:15

连视频是什么都不就在想无线传输了,先老老实实把图像采集到VGA上显示吧

pengchhui 发表于 2015-4-2 12:33:07

loopinnova 发表于 2015-4-2 10:11
USB没弄过听说比串口难很多。。

或者直接VGA,DVI上传,这个就很简单了,速度也快

cxhy 发表于 2015-4-2 12:43:16

loopinnova 发表于 2015-4-2 10:12
FPGA也有DMA?

自己写一个啊

cxhy 发表于 2015-4-2 13:00:51

我来总结一下吧
FPGA控制OV7670采集这个没问题。
采集之后数据的和传输有问题
1,通过串口传数据,不行,不要考虑了
2,通过USB传数据,楼主觉得难
3,通过网口传数据,应该更难
4,通过无线模块的话可能可以,wifi应该搞得定,难度的话wifi>网口>>USB>>串口(个人感觉)。
5,我之前建议楼主写一个DMA,当我没说好了
6,把采集到的数据直接通过VGA显示到显示屏上,相比较而言最简单。
7,授人以渔一下,楼主你想想OV7670的速率大概是多少?25M吧,你控制采集系统输出数据的时钟怎么也不会比这个频率低吧,串口也好,其他的什么方式也好,第一频率不能比这个低,第二数据的位宽至少要大于OV7670的数据输出位宽吧。满足这俩个条件之后,我们再讨论哪个传输方式是合理的。

MetalSeed 发表于 2015-4-2 17:57:32

loopinnova 发表于 2015-4-2 12:18
嗯 那有什么无线方式可以传输的

wifi可以

有线USB MIPI parella三种最常见

YFM 发表于 2015-4-2 18:05:06

320*240 30帧每秒 先H.264压缩再通过串口传有可能。不过你要在fpga里做H.264那是相当麻烦。

uindex 发表于 2015-4-2 19:50:14

YFM 发表于 2015-4-2 18:05
320*240 30帧每秒 先H.264压缩再通过串口传有可能。不过你要在fpga里做H.264那是相当麻烦。 ...

这个相当麻烦的东西才是使用FPGA来搞定的乐趣所在,使用串口传视频,简直就是把电脑当计算器用。

mofire 发表于 2015-4-3 00:20:47

uindex 发表于 2015-4-2 19:50
这个相当麻烦的东西才是使用FPGA来搞定的乐趣所在,使用串口传视频,简直就是把电脑当计算器用。 ...

应该是把计算器当电脑用!

gnocy 发表于 2015-4-7 18:41:42

loopinnova 发表于 2015-4-2 12:17
嗯?就是把FPGA采集的视频通过无线传输到PC 有什么方法

这个可以的,一般的2.4G会有些卡,WiFi就没什么问题

fuxinaries 发表于 2015-4-8 00:12:25

借贵宝地问一下,入门网口哪种芯片比较合适?FPGA主控的话
页: [1]
查看完整版本: 关于FPGA+OV7670视频采集传输